Samuel Johnson's Dictionary
Sponginessnoun
Softness and fulness of cavities like a sponge.
Etymology: from spongy.
The lungs are exposed to receive all the droppings from the brain: a very fit cistern, because of their sponginess. Gideon Harvey.
ChatGPT
sponginess
Sponginess refers to the quality or state of being soft and full of holes like a sponge, or easily compressed, flexible and resilient. It can also refer to the ability of a material or substance to absorb or soak up a liquid. This term is often used to describe the texture of certain foods or the feeling of certain surfaces or materials.
